OptiMUM Nutrition: a web-based dietary intervention in pregnancy to optimise neonatal outcomes

Completed
Conditions
Pregnancy, gestational diabetes
Pregnancy and Childbirth
Registration Number
ISRCTN49955056
Lead Sponsor
Dublin Institute of Technology (Ireland)

Recruitment & Eligibility

Status
Completed
Sex
Female
Target Recruitment
500
Inclusion Criteria

Current inclusion criteria as of 09/10/2017:
1. Women with a singleton pregnancy
2. Aged over 18
3. Have internet access
4. Proficient English
5. <18 weeks gestation

Previous inclusion criteria:
1. Women with a singleton pregnancy
2. Aged over 18
3. Have internet access
4. Proficient English
5. In their first trimester of pregnancy

Exclusion Criteria

Women who do not meet the inclusion criteria

Study & Design

Study Type
Interventional
Study Design
Not specified
Primary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Current primary outcome measures as of 09/10/2017:<br>Birth weight, measured as part of standard antenatal and postnatal care<br><br>Previous primary outcome measures:<br>Neonatal weight and health status
Secondary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Current secondary outcome measures as of 09/10/2017:<br>1. Maternal engagement with the website, measured using web-stat analytics from recruitment at baseline throughout the gestational period<br>2. Neonatal OFC, measured as part of standard antenatal and postnatal care<br>3. Maternal GDM diagnosis, measured as part of standard antenatal and postnatal care<br>4. Maternal mode of delivery, measured as part of standard antenatal and postnatal care<br>5. Neonatal mode of feeding, measured as part of standard antenatal and postnatal care<br><br>Previous secondary outcome measures:<br>1. Maternal weight <br>2. Maternal dietary intakes <br>3. Maternal dietary quality <br>4. Maternal blood glucose and serum lipids<br>5. Maternal dietary and lifestyle knowledge <br>6. Maternal psychometric measurements
